How to Plan a No-Stress Weekend for Ultimate Relaxation



Spread the love

Taking time to unwind is essential for maintaining a healthy balance in life. A no-stress weekend gives you the chance to relax, recharge, and reset. But how can you plan a weekend that truly refreshes you, without feeling overwhelmed or rushed? In this post, we’ll walk through practical steps to help you design a calm, fulfilling weekend.

Why a No-Stress Weekend Matters

Busy schedules and everyday pressures can add up quickly. Without breaks, stress can accumulate and affect your mood, sleep, and overall health. Planning a weekend focused on relaxation helps you step away from stressors and return to your routine with renewed energy.

Step 1: Set the Intention

Start by deciding what you want from your weekend. Do you want to relax at home, enjoy nature, or catch up on hobbies? Setting a clear intention helps you prioritize activities that bring you peace instead of busyness.

Tips:

– Write down your goals for the weekend.

– Keep your plans flexible—allow room for spontaneity.

– Avoid over-scheduling to prevent feeling rushed.

Step 2: Simplify Your To-Do List

Before the weekend arrives, take a moment to organize your responsibilities. Completing urgent tasks earlier in the week or delegating chores can free your weekend from unnecessary worries.

How to simplify:

– Make a list of what must be done before the weekend.

– Identify tasks that can wait or be shared with family or friends.

– Let go of perfection—focus on what’s necessary.

Step 3: Create a Relaxing Environment

Your surroundings influence your state of mind. Creating a calm, welcoming environment supports relaxation.

Ideas for your space:

– Declutter common areas to reduce visual stress.

– Add soft lighting with lamps or candles.

– Incorporate soothing scents like lavender or eucalyptus.

– Play gentle background music or nature sounds.

Step 4: Plan Enjoyable Activities

Choose activities that help you unwind and feel happy. These can be simple pleasures or new experiences, but they should align with your weekend intention.

Examples:

– Reading a favorite book or listening to podcasts.

– Taking a leisurely walk or spending time outdoors.

– Cooking a comforting meal or trying a new recipe.

– Practicing mindfulness or meditation.

– Watching a movie or show you enjoy.

Remember, relaxation doesn’t mean you must be inactive—engaging in hobbies or light movement can be refreshing.

Step 5: Limit Digital Distractions

Technology can be both helpful and distracting. To reduce stress, set boundaries with your devices.

Suggestions:

– Designate tech-free times during your weekend.

– Turn off non-essential notifications.

– Replace screen time with offline activities.

– Use your phone mindfully to avoid information overload.

Step 6: Prioritize Rest and Sleep

Rest is the cornerstone of a stress-free weekend. Prioritize quality sleep and downtime.

Tips for better rest:

– Stick to a comfortable sleep schedule.

– Create a calming bedtime routine.

– Avoid caffeine or heavy meals before bed.

– Take short naps if you feel tired during the day.

Step 7: Nourish Your Body

Eating well supports your mood and energy. Use the weekend to enjoy healthy, satisfying meals.

Ideas:

– Plan simple, wholesome recipes.

– Stay hydrated with water, herbal teas, or fresh juices.

– Treat yourself to a favorite snack in moderation.

– Avoid excessive alcohol or junk food that may disrupt your relaxation.

Step 8: Connect Meaningfully

Spending quality time with loved ones or yourself can enhance your well-being.

Ways to connect:

– Have relaxed conversations with family or friends.

– Practice gratitude by journaling or reflecting.

– Engage in creative activities like drawing or writing.

– Enjoy quiet moments alone for introspection.

Bonus Tips for a Successful No-Stress Weekend

Prepare ahead: Lay out clothes, groceries, or materials to reduce last-minute stress.

Listen to your body: Rest if you feel tired; be active if you feel energetic.

Be mindful: Notice what helps you feel calm and do more of it.

Say no: Avoid commitments that add pressure during your relaxation time.
